Definition of Narrow / Difficult
Ad-diq: the opposite of width.
One also says ad-dayq and ad-dayqa.
The Almighty says: 'Do not be in distress' (An-Nahl 127). 'And my chest tightens' (Ash-Shu'ara 13).
